White House says Hegseth authorised admiral to strike alleged drug boat.

Extract from ABC News

Pete Hegseth looking at the camera with a stern expression and furrowed brow.

US Secretary of Defense Pete Hegseth has defended the attacks on Venzuela vessels as lawful.  (Reuters: Yves Herman)

In short: 

The White House says US Secretary of Defense Pete Hegseth authorised an admiral to conduct multiple strikes on Venezuelan boats suspected of smuggling drugs. 

Press secretary Karoline Leavitt says Admiral Frank Bradley worked well within his authority and the law in conducting the strikes. 

What's next? 

Politicians from both parties have announced support for congressional reviews of US military strikes against vessels suspected of smuggling drugs
